Sarajevo War Tunnel Museum
Bosnia and Herzegovina

In the midst of the Bosnian War, during the Siege of Sarajevo that lasted for 4 years, the people of Sarajevo were trapped and starving,... living in their basements. In 1993 the Bosnian army built the Sarajevo Tunnel known as the Tunnel of Hope. The purpose of the tunnel was to deliver food and supplies to those in need. The 800 meters long, 1 m wide, 1.6 meters high tunnel was the city's lifeline to the outside world. Historians estimate that more than 1 million trips were taken through the tunnel and about 20 million tons of food were transported through here. Today, about 20 meters of tunnel are part of a museum which contains a collection of objects, archival documents and authentic video material made during the time of the Siege of Sarajevo.

Zabljak
Montenegro

The massif of Durmitor became national park in 1952 because of its exceptional natural beauty and distinctive landscape and as of 2005 it is also... included in UNESCO World’s Natural Heritage in its full span. It is visited by a great number of tourists every year especially the Tara River Canyon, Europe's deepest gorge. This exceptional scenic beauty offers a great range of sport activities such as hiking, climbing and canoeing. Zabljak, a typical mountain town with colorful houses is a well known ski resort. Besides the extraordinary landscape beauty, Durmitor National Park is also characterized by a wealth of an impressive biological diversity.

Podgorica
Montenegro

The capital of Montenegro is rich in history since it has been continuously inhabited since the Illyrian and Roman eras. The basis of today’s Podgorica... is a riverfront village built by the Slavic tribes, on the remains of ancient Roman hamlet. Since then, it was ruled by different governs from Turks to the Austro-Hungarians, thus different influences can be observed in its structure. Having a reputation as a party city, Podgorica is proud of its vibrant cafés/bars/restaurants culture.

Shkoder
Albania

Being established since the Bronze Age, Shkoder is one of the most historic cities in Albania. It is also one of country’s culturally and economically... most important city. The most notable tourist attraction in Shkodra certainly is the Rozafa Castle, a former Illyrian stronghold. Besides being the city’s greatest heritage site it also offers a beautiful panoramic view of the entire Shkoder and its surroundings. While in Shkoder you shouldn’t miss the St Stephen's Catholic Cathedral which dates from the 19th century but was used as a sports facility under communist rule. Another site of interest is the Site of Witness and Memory that commemorates victims of communist regime. If you have time to spare, be sure to visit Shkodra Lake renowned for its natural beauty.

Kruje Castle
Albania

Kruje castle is built 560 meters above sea level surrounded by scenic natural beauty. It is one of the Albanian pivotal historical sites as it... is linked to the victories against the Ottoman Empire led by the national hero, George Skanderberg. Guided tours are available in English through which visitors can learn about the rich Albanian history. Inside the Kruje castle is the Ethnographic museum considered one of the best organized museums in Albania.
